Weighing in at 3/32oz (2.5g), the brass blade on this spinner features crisp stamping that identifies its French origins. The Mepps Aglia 0 is a legendary design, and this unit, cataloged under product code 10558, measures 1 3/4" (4.5cm) in total length. Stamped into the gold-toned metal are the words "MEPPS AGLIA" and "BRITISH FRENCH PAT.," with "MADE IN FRANCE" clearly visible on the reverse. The body is constructed with a solid brass round bead and two conical brass spacers arranged on a stainless steel wire. A distinctive red sleeve is fitted over the shank of the treble hook, a classic visual trigger used by Mepps for decades. Originally invented in France by Andre Meulnart in 1938, these lures were assembled in the USA using imported French components. This example is in 5/5 condition, appearing remarkably clean with its original metal luster intact. The clevis and cone rotation system are engineered to facilitate the blade's rotation during a steady retrieve.
